how much priming sugar

Im in the process of brewing john bull best bitter, its still in primary fermintation and im planning on putting it in glass 500ml bottles .I used gorrdie brew enhancer for the primary fermentation and im going to use coopers brew enhancer 2 for the secondary .Just wanted to know how much to use in each bottle?.Also as soon as that ones out the wort im gonna be doing a coopers indian pale ale ,a friend of mine said he used thomas  coopers i p a with 1kg of coopers  brew enhance 2 and 500g of  dried light malt extract spraymalt . Will this be ok ? this is also going in 500ml glass bottles with coopers brew enhance 2 for secondary fermentation ,Looking forward to  hearing from you .

    If you're going to prime with enhancer 2 we would suggest about a level teaspoon per 500ml bottle, which should be about right. The Coopers IPA is recomended by Coopers to be made with 500g of Light Dry Malt and 300g of sugar - so using 1000g of enhancer and also 500g of spraymalt would potentially make it stronger with the increased amounts of sugars, and also sweeter. Your friend will be able to best advise on how it turned out if he's already done it, the IPA can probably take this though, and we think it would probably turn out with a good result, but there is no reaso why not to experiment with brews and alter them to your liking and make something a bit different, let us know how you get on wont you....
